Patent number: 10190954Abstract: A composite test coupon includes a plurality of plies. The plurality of plies include first ply layers and second ply layers. The first ply layers have first fibers and a substantially uniform matrix material associated with the first fibers. The second ply layers have second fibers and a pre-stressed matrix material associated with the second fibers. The first fibers are oriented in a first direction, and the second fibers are oriented in a second direction that is different from the first direction. The pre-stressed matrix material includes stress induced cracks between the second fibers of each of the second ply layers.Type: GrantFiled: June 1, 2015Date of Patent: January 29, 2019Assignee: THE BOEING COMPANYInventors: Jack J. Esposito, Samuel J. Tucker

Patent number: 10078041Abstract: One example of the present disclosure relates to a coupon. The coupon includes a first surface with a first circular channel and a second surface opposite and parallel to the first surface. The second surface is spaced a distance D0 from the first surface and includes a second circular channel concentric with the first circular channel. The coupon also includes a toroidal portion between the first circular channel and the second circular channel. The toroidal portion includes a rectangular sectional portion.Type: GrantFiled: July 6, 2017Date of Patent: September 18, 2018Assignee: The Boeing CompanyInventors: Joshua Shane Dustin, Jack J. Esposito, Alan W. Baker

Patent number: 10035323Abstract: An article comprises a multi-directional textile of first reinforcing fiber tows extending in a first direction and second reinforcing fiber tows extending in a second direction. Filaments in the first fiber tows extend past a boundary of the textile and are spread. The tows are embedded in resin.Type: GrantFiled: September 23, 2013Date of Patent: July 31, 2018Assignee: The Boeing CompanyInventors: Kenneth H. Griess, Jack J. Esposito, Gary E. Georgeson

Patent number: 9630376Abstract: A method and apparatus for forming a composite filler is presented. The method comprises cutting a number of layers from a composite material. The method also aligns the number of layers to form a composite filler having a cross-sectional shape. Each of the number of layers has fibers in plane with the cross-sectional shape.Type: GrantFiled: September 22, 2014Date of Patent: April 25, 2017Assignee: THE BOEING COMPANYInventors: Kenneth H. Griess, Jack J. Esposito

Patent number: 9464975Abstract: A particular composite test specimen includes a first tab, a second tab, and a gage section between the first tab and the second tab. The first tab, the second tab, and the gage section are machined from a composite test blank. The composite test blank includes a plurality of plies arranged with first ply layers having fibers oriented in a first direction and second ply layers having fibers oriented in a second direction, where the first direction is different than the second direction.Type: GrantFiled: August 13, 2014Date of Patent: October 11, 2016Assignee: The Boeing CompanyInventors: Jack J. Esposito, Joshua S. Dustin

Patent number: 9239236Abstract: An alignment apparatus for aligning a test panel with a testing machine may include a laser measuring system and an adjustment mechanism. The laser measuring system may include at least one laser measuring device coupled to a test fixture and/or a testing machine. The laser measuring system may generate laser measurement data representative of an orientation of a test panel relative to a platen and/or a loading axis of the testing machine. The adjustment mechanism may adjust, based on the laser measurement data, a location and/or orientation of the test panel relative to the platen and/or the loading axis in a manner such that the test panel is moved into substantially alignment with the platen and/or the loading axis.Type: GrantFiled: February 19, 2014Date of Patent: January 19, 2016Assignee: The Boeing CompanyInventors: Kenneth H. Griess, Jack J. Esposito

Patent number: 8707798Abstract: A testing apparatus for characterizing a tension strength of a fillet bond of a test specimen may include a lower fixture and an upper fixture. The test specimen may include a skin component bonded to a stiffener component. The lower fixture may maintain the stiffener component in a fixed position. The upper fixture may engage the skin component at a pair of discrete engagement locations on opposite sides of the fillet bond. The upper fixture may be mechanically coupled to a gimbal joint and may substantially isolate the filet bond from asymmetric bending during application of a tension test load to the fillet bond.Type: GrantFiled: June 25, 2012Date of Patent: April 29, 2014Assignee: The Boeing CompanyInventors: Paul S. Gregg, Brian S. Kasperson, Jack J. Esposito
